Strategies for Effective Online Learning:

Following some strategies for online learning can help you take the best out of it. No matter if you are a student or a working professional, here are some valuable tips for you.

Set Your Goals:

You must set your daily goals to beat procrastination in any online course. Make sure your goal is easily achievable and specific.

Be organized:

Ensure that you have all the required learning materials before the course begins. Also, you must know how to navigate through different modules of any course.

Create A Time Table For Study:

If you want to avoid a last-minute rush in completing the course, dedicate a few hours every day to watching videos, participating in discussions and writing assignments. Make sure that you strictly follow the study hours.

Set Up A Dedicated Learning Space:

Whenever you learn something, it becomes easier to recall it in the same place. So, create a dedicated study place for watching videos and completing assignments. Set aside any kind of distractions and make the place conducive for study.

Be Active During Videos and Online Classes:

Always be active in participating in discussions and in collaborating with your peers. While watching videos, note down important points. Taking notes along with learning keeps you more engaged, enhances your comprehensive ability and promotes active thinking.

Avoid Multitasking While Learning:

Multitasking is good when you handle home or office errands but when it comes to studying, it makes you less productive. Try to focus on one thing at a time as it will help you absorb most of it easily and effectively.  If you throw yourself into multiple sources at one time, you will find it difficult to pay attention and recall anything that you learned.

Break is Important:

You can increase your brain’s performance by giving it regular rest time. Try to go for a walk or talk to your friend after studying 1-2 hours in one stretch.

Online Learning Advantages:

Removing the major barrier of in-person education, online learning has become quite popular. However, learning its benefits can help you decide better whether this option is meant for you or not.

Flexible:

The flexibility of online learning sources has made it possible for many to complete and continue their education. There are courses that you can complete at your own pace, giving you ample time to learn content and complete assignments. Whether you like to study in the morning or during evening hours, it’s up to you.

Also, you get access to a wide range of study programs and courses.

No Relocation Required:               

Whether you want a degree, a professional certificate or any other qualification, you can get access to any desired course from any institution or any professional leader. There is no need to move across countries and pay relocation costs; instead, the classroom will come to you.

Apart from the relocation costs, you will also save money spent on food and commuting.

Work and Study Go Hand in Hand:

Traditional classroom education requires you to quit your job or be on education leave and even if not, it becomes challenging for you to maintain a balance between education and professional obligations. On the contrary, online learning does not demand any such thing. You can learn at your own pace, in your own space and in your own time. Many people complete their degrees while working part-time or full-time.

Opportunity to Get Engaged With Global Community:

As online learning for adults has global access, you might find peers from all around the world. Such a diverse group helps you build greater insights and wider perspectives. In the online programs, you get an opportunity to engage with such students, know their opinions, and get an opportunity to learn diverse things from them.

Online Learning Disadvantages:

Everything comes with its pros and cons and online learning is also not an exception. Here are a few disadvantages of online learning that you should be aware of.

Social Isolation:

Sometimes, students miss social interactions in online classes that happen in physical classes. Lack of face-to-face interaction can make things mundane and boring.

Repetition:

The structure of the online course module is repetitive, which makes it boring sometimes. You have to watch a video, discuss some points and submit an answer. You have to repeat the same process for all modules, making students disengage gradually.

Require Self-motivation:

In online learning, you need to be self-disciplined and manage your time effectively to stay organized and motivated. Lack of physical interactions with the peer group and professors can make you lose consistency over time.

Difficult to Monitor Cheating:

As said above, you need to be self-disciplined in online classes, if you are not sincere, the integrity of the course is compromised. Monitoring cheating becomes difficult; however online learning platforms are coming up with new strategies in this regard.

Inaccessible for People With Computer Illiteracy:

The main components of online learning are computers and the availability of the Internet. People, who do not have access to computers or laptops or lack internet connectivity in their area, can’t access any online learning platform.
